A quarter of children from six months to five years and pregnant women and infants examined last week at the Médecins Sin Frontières (MSF) facilities in Gaza suffered from malnutrition, denounced the NGO this Friday, July 25.
“The deliberate use of hunger as a gun by Israeli authorities in Gaza has reached unprecedented levels, patients and health professionals suffering from hunger,” MSF warns in a statement.
Caroline Willemen, project coordinator at the MSF Clinic in the city of Gaza, explains that they register “now 25 new patients with malnutrition every day.” In this clinic, the number of people with malnutrition has quadrupled since May 18 and the severe malnutrition rate in children under five years of age has tripled in the last two weeks.
“This is a deliberate famine, caused by Israeli authorities in the context of the current genocidal campaign. Transmitting, killing and hurting people who desperately seek help is unacceptable,” MSF said.
Very serious shortage
Israel, whose offensive began the day after the attack on the Palestinian Islamist movement Hamas on October 7, 2023, faces increasing international pressure on the dramatic humanitarian situation in Gaza. A total imposed blockade at the beginning of March at the Palestinian enclave was softened very partially, which led to a very serious shortage of food, drugs and other basic needs.
Israel, meanwhile, accuses the Islamist movement Hamas of exploiting the suffering of civilians, in particular when stealing food distributed to resell it at exorbitant prices or shoot people who expect help.
Meanwhile, the MSF alert, “the attacks continue in the food distribution sites, where the distribution mechanism sponsored by the Israeli authorities through the Humanine Foundation of Gaza (GHF), repeatedly kills people who desperately seek to get help.”
The UN accused the Israeli army on Tuesday of having killed Gaza since the end of May, more than 1,000 people who sought to obtain humanitarian aid, the vast majority of which near this foundation, also supported by the United States.
“War crimes”
“These food distributions are not humanitarian aid, they are war crimes committed in broad daylight and under the appearance of compassion. Those who go to the food distributions of the GHF know that they have such a chance of receiving a flour bag to go out with a ball in the head,” said Dr. Mohammed Abu Mughaisib, subconscious Medical Coordinator of MSF in Gaza.
In addition to the injured people in the GHF distribution sites, MSF teams have treated dozens of people injured by the Israeli army while waiting for trucks that transported flour.
On July 20, the MSF medical teams and the Ministry of Health of the Sheikh Radwan Clinic in Northern Gaza treated 122 people injured by bullet while waiting for a flour distribution, and 46 people have already died when they arrived. On July 3, an MSF employee died in an incident similar to Khan Younès.
